Today's video will show you the practical application of a heat exchanger in the EPS block plant. See how the factory uses waste steam to save energy.
    In the video, you can see three pipes from left to right connected to the EPS batch pre-expanding machine, the EPS block molding machine, and the condensate discharge outlet respectively.
    The size of this heat exchanger is 3 meters long and 1.3 meters wide. There is a pipe behind the heat exchanger, connected to the drying room, which is used for heating the drying room and can reduce aging time for EPS blocks.
    In addition, the buffer tank below this heat exchanger is also wrapped with a layer of insulation to better utilize heat.
